Continuing Medical Education (CME) Mission Statement

The Vision of the SCA CME Program: The Society is committed to the advancement of perioperative care of patients with cardiovascular and thoracic diseases through education and research.

The Mission of the SCA CME Program: In support of the Society's mission statement, the mission of the Society's CME program is to provide anesthesiologists, through a broad variety of educational meetings, enduring materials, and electronic media, with the information and skills that will reinforce their knowledge base and introduce new concepts and clinical practice skills involving the perioperative care of patients with cardiovascular and thoracic disease. It is expected that these educational opportunities will enhance the practitioners clinical practice skills.

The Goals of the SCA CME Program:

  1. To provide ongoing CME activities designed to enhance:
    1. the understanding of cardiovascular and pulmonary physiology,
    2. the treatment of disease processes affecting the cardiovascular and pulmonary systems,
    3. the perioperative management of patients with these disease processes, and
    4. the knowledge of the most efficacious and newest perioperative care for these patients;
  2. To provide an Annual Scientific Meeting to the members as a forum for knowledge that includes the opportunity for expression of new clinical insights, research results, hands-on applications and courses that will enhance the effectiveness and cost efficiencies of perioperative care for cardiovascular and thoracic applications;
  3. To provide state-of-the-art meetings dealing with specific topics that will enhance the clinical effectiveness and cost effectiveness of cardiovascular and thoracic perioperative care;
  4. To consider, with full compliance of the ACCME's Essentials, joint sponsorship, with non-accredited entities of meetings that meet the mission of SCA.

Types of Education Formats: CME activities may contain any combination of the following educational formats: plenary sessions, concurrent sessions, workshops, roundtables, refresher courses, poster discussions, video tape presentations and demonstrations, publications, case discussions, internet education and electronic media.

Participants in SCA CME Activities: 1) Attendance and/or registration shall be open to all healthcare practitioners, provided an appropriate registration fee is paid; 2) CME credit will only be offered to M.D.s or D.O.s, or the equivalent. Certificates of Attendance will be offered to all registrants.
